Key Ingredients For Cranberry Balsamic Roast Beef
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Beef Roast: A cut like chuck or eye round works best for roasting, as it provides great flavor and tenderness when cooked properly.
- Fresh Cranberries: Opt for bright red cranberries; they add a tartness that balances beautifully with the sweetness of the sauce.
- Balsamic Vinegar: Use high-quality balsamic vinegar for a rich depth of flavor; it enhances both sweetness and acidity in the dish.
- Brown Sugar: This ingredient brings caramelization and balances out the tartness from the cranberries.
- Garlic Cloves: Fresh garlic provides aromatic notes that complement the beef perfectly.
- Fresh Herbs: Rosemary or thyme adds an earthy touch; fresh herbs elevate the overall flavor profile of your roast.
For the Seasoning:
- Salt and Pepper: Essential for enhancing flavors; season generously for a well-rounded taste.

Instructions For Cranberry Balsamic Roast Beef
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
First Step: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C). While it’s heating, select a suitable roasting pan that can accommodate your beef roast comfortably.
Second Step: Prepare the Marinade
In a mixing bowl, combine fresh cranberries, balsamic vinegar, brown sugar, minced garlic, salt, and pepper. Stir until well mixed; this marinade will infuse your roast with amazing flavors.
Third Step: Season the Beef
Pat the beef roast dry with paper towels. Generously season all sides with salt and pepper. This step ensures flavor penetrates deeply into the meat.
Fourth Step: Sear the Roast
Heat a bit of o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, sear each side of the beef roast for about 3-4 minutes until browned. This creates a savory crust that seals in juices.
Fifth Step: Combine and Roast
Place the seared beef in your roasting pan. Pour the cranberry mixture over it evenly. Cover with foil and bake for approximately 1 hour or until reaching your desired doneness.
Sixth Step: Rest Before Serving
Once cooked, remove from oven and let rest for at least 15 minutes before slicing. This allows juices to redistribute throughout the meat.
Transfer to plates and drizzle with extra cranberry sauce for the perfect finishing touch.

Storage Tips
If you have leftover Cranberry Balsamic Roast Beef, store it properly to maintain its flavor. Wrap any remaining slices in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and place them in an airtight container. The roast can stay fresh in your refrigerator for up to three days.
For longer storage, consider freezing leftover slices. Place them in freezer-safe bags or containers after wrapping them tightly. In this way, you can enjoy this delectable roast later on without losing its taste.
When ready to eat frozen leftovers, thaw them overnight in the refrigerator before reheating gently in an oven or microwave.

Cranberry Balsamic Roast Beef
Cranberry Balsamic Roast Beef is a delightful dish that combines succulent beef with a tangy cranberry and balsamic glaze, perfect for any special occasion. The tender meat absorbs the sweet-tart flavors, creating a memorable centerpiece for family dinners and holiday feasts. With its inviting aroma and rich taste, this roast will surely impress your guests while being simple enough for home cooks to master.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 60 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
- Yield: Serves approximately 6
- Category: Main
- Method: Roasting
- Cuisine: American
Ingredients
- 3 lb beef roast (chuck or eye round)
- 1 cup fresh cranberries
- 1/2 cup balsamic vinegar
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 4 garlic cloves (minced)
- 1 tbsp fresh rosemary (chopped)
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- 2 tbsp olive oil
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C).
- In a bowl, mix cranberries, balsamic vinegar, brown sugar, minced garlic, salt, and pepper to create the marinade.
- Pat the beef roast dry and season generously with salt and pepper.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at and sear the beef on all sides until browned (3-4 minutes each side).
- Place the seared beef in a roasting pan and pour the marinade over it. Cover with foil.
- Roast in the preheated oven for about 1 hour or until desired doneness is reached.
- Let the roast rest for at least 15 minutes before slicing.
